I've received a good advice to model table of caracteristics with http://tdg.docbook.org/tdg/5.0/segmentedlist.html

In the body of a text, what is a good way to model a value with the associated unit ?
Example : I am <data><value>1,8</value> <unit>m</unit></data> high

Need is to avoid <data>1,8meter</data> or <unit>meter</unit>, <unit>M.</unit> to enable consistency (readability) or even conversion between units
